Sébastien Warin
|
9b29f8c23a
|
Fix MqttProtocolVersion 3.1 connection
|
6 years ago |
Christian
|
8077d8dfeb
|
Refactor TopicFilterComparer
|
6 years ago |
Sébastien Warin
|
5e0bc17341
|
Removing the debug log messages
|
6 years ago |
Sébastien Warin
|
932aa1fd39
|
Fixes chkr1011's refactoing and pass all tests
|
6 years ago |
Sébastien Warin
|
c1352d50c1
|
Review code style to match with the existing code
|
6 years ago |
Christian
|
2499d29196
|
Refactor events.
|
6 years ago |
Christian
|
fbf1cbc76e
|
Refactor ConnectedClient statistics API
|
6 years ago |
Christian
|
719838de3b
|
Add new server option to disable/enable persistent sessions.
|
6 years ago |
Sébastien Warin
|
ba66c108fa
|
Fixes and clean the new topic matcher from israellot
|
6 years ago |
Sébastien Warin
|
5287bf5cac
|
Codacy/PR Quality Review
|
6 years ago |
Sébastien Warin
|
10740f12c4
|
Replace the Async coordination primitives
|
6 years ago |
Christian
|
3e6edb92c5
|
Refactor ASP.NET integration.
|
6 years ago |
Christian
|
dc7b9414d9
|
Refactor logging. Remove TCP adapter from HTTP host if disabled.
|
6 years ago |
Christian
|
8df8cb1eb6
|
Refactor logging and add benchmark.
|
6 years ago |
Christian
|
e14ea9a240
|
Add overflow strategy for pending messages queue.
|
6 years ago |
Christian
|
febc8f774d
|
Start a dedicated thread per client.
|
6 years ago |
Christian
|
e51042ed04
|
Update UWP version
|
6 years ago |
VladimirAkopyan
|
7b987635f7
|
ref #230 Limiting the growth of PendingMessagesQueue to a configurable value. it will only store X lated messages, 250 by default.
https://github.com/chkr1011/MQTTnet/issues/230
|
6 years ago |
JanEggers
|
8c37cf16c0
|
fixed tests
|
6 years ago |
JanEggers
|
c569c10740
|
dont use writer instance
|
6 years ago |
JanEggers
|
e7a7bb1a7b
|
added benchmark for serializers
|
6 years ago |
Christian
|
b621806a7c
|
Update build config
|
6 years ago |
Christian
|
7720a3f091
|
Refactor thread management.
|
6 years ago |
Christian
|
b22b02a0b6
|
Refactor subscriptions manager
|
6 years ago |
Christian
|
d14088512b
|
Refactoring
|
6 years ago |
Christian
|
62527a91ac
|
Complete merge
|
6 years ago |
Christian
|
aaed2ed790
|
Process client messages in worker thread (extend options)
|
6 years ago |
Christian
|
d9501de252
|
Treat a connection handover as a clean disconnect.
|
6 years ago |
Christian
|
b9a73cc23d
|
Changed socket features.
|
6 years ago |
Christian
|
357fd844d7
|
Fix TopicFilterComparer
|
6 years ago |
Christian
|
74a5522965
|
Add topic filter tests from MQTT spec
|
6 years ago |
Christian
|
84dab18c2a
|
Fix broken UWP support.
|
6 years ago |
Christian
|
9e90111b37
|
Fix several deadlocks
|
6 years ago |
Christian
|
ffb1645f14
|
Refactoring
|
6 years ago |
Christian
|
af8d1ec6be
|
Refactoring
|
6 years ago |
Israel Lot
|
942bf70582
|
one less copy and allocation
|
6 years ago |
Christian
|
cb09bac246
|
Refactor the WebSocket channel and remove the internal queue.
|
6 years ago |
Christian
|
109e4b2cf1
|
Refactor the task timeout code to avoid still running tasks if the timeout is reached.
|
6 years ago |
Israel Lot
|
e4cf2978e6
|
Remove useless sempahore object
|
6 years ago |
Christian
|
17b74f20c9
|
Migrate to Stream-less approach.
|
6 years ago |
Christian
|
ae11e31048
|
Refactoring
|
6 years ago |
Israel Lot
|
5300742543
|
Avoid unnecessary enumeration for every packet
|
6 years ago |
Israel Lot
|
cd09a2f176
|
Fix code style
|
6 years ago |
Israel Lot
|
11ba46d140
|
Remove useless stream flush
|
6 years ago |
Israel Lot
|
e006377e64
|
Fix zero lenght packets bug
|
6 years ago |
Israel Lot
|
9bc34e4406
|
Translate timeout exception
|
6 years ago |
Israel Lot
|
c915af8dad
|
Disable Nagle on sockets, send packets in one shot.
|
6 years ago |
Christian
|
d2049d63d6
|
Refactoring minor issues
|
6 years ago |
Israel Lot
|
a5f33bc244
|
Replace double dictionary with a tuple key
|
6 years ago |
Christian
|
1df6798934
|
Fix issues in RPC extension.
|
6 years ago |